Qiujie Jiang is a scholar working on Genetics, Cell Biology and Molecular Biology. According to data from OpenAlex, Qiujie Jiang has authored 37 papers receiving a total of 1.4k indexed citations (citations by other indexed papers that have themselves been cited), including 28 papers in Genetics, 21 papers in Cell Biology and 18 papers in Molecular Biology. Recurrent topics in Qiujie Jiang’s work include Dermatological and Skeletal Disorders (24 papers), Biology and Pathology of Keratins and Related Disorders (21 papers) and Heterotopic Ossification and Related Conditions (7 papers). Qiujie Jiang is often cited by papers focused on Dermatological and Skeletal Disorders (24 papers), Biology and Pathology of Keratins and Related Disorders (21 papers) and Heterotopic Ossification and Related Conditions (7 papers). Qiujie Jiang collaborates with scholars based in United States, China and Germany. Qiujie Jiang's co-authors include Jouni Uitto, Qiaoli Li, András Váradi, Leon J. Schurgers, Yasushi Matsuzaki, Ellen G Pfendner, Masayuki Endo, Holm Schneider, Leena Pulkkinen and Aoi Nakano and has published in prestigious journals such as Neurology, The Science of The Total Environment and Biochemical and Biophysical Research Communications.
